Don't Pay the Price of the Obesity Epidemic
Based on solid studies, two-thirds of Americans are overweight or obese. This alarming statistic goes well beyond the initial “WOW!”reaction one has when first hearing it. Being overweight has negative consequences on many fronts for those faced with weight issues—and it's affecting their employers' corporate bottom lines, too. Health care insurers have increased premiums by double-digits to cover an ever-expanding menu of chronic health conditions—many attributable to weight issues. It's just one way Corporations are bearing the financial weight of America's biggest health crisis.
